- Starting the Investigation Immediately – The clock starts ticking the second an accident occurs. Physical evidence, like skid marks, debris, or fluid leaks, can be washed away by rain, cleared by emergency services, or damaged by subsequent traffic. Similarly, surveillance footage from nearby businesses often gets overwritten within a matter of days or weeks. Witness recollections are sharpest immediately after an event, and details can become muddled over time. Because of these factors, our team mobilizes rapidly. We prioritize contacting witnesses, dispatching investigators to the scene if feasible, and sending out preservation letters to secure vital evidence before it’s lost forever. This immediate response significantly improves our ability to piece together exactly what happened and who was responsible.
- Protecting Crucial Evidence from the Outset – Protecting evidence isn’t just about collecting what’s available; it’s about actively safeguarding what’s vulnerable. This involves several critical steps right from the start. We often issue spoliation letters to involved parties, particularly businesses or government entities, demanding they preserve any and all relevant information, from security camera footage to maintenance logs. For vehicle accidents, we might arrange for detailed inspections of the vehicles involved before they’re repaired or salvaged, ensuring that mechanical failures or points of impact are thoroughly documented. - On-Scene Investigations (if applicable and timely) – When possible and beneficial to your case, our team acts quickly to conduct an on-scene investigation. This is especially crucial in the immediate aftermath of an accident before the scene can be altered or cleared. We’re looking for perishable evidence that might otherwise disappear, such as skid marks, debris fields, fluid spills, or damage to surrounding property. These physical indicators can provide invaluable insights into vehicle speeds, points of impact, and the sequence of events.
- Photographing and Video Recording the Accident Scene – Visual evidence is incredibly powerful. We meticulously photograph and video record the accident scene from multiple angles and distances. This includes close-ups of vehicle damage, road conditions, traffic signs, signals, relevant landmarks, and any visible injuries. High-quality visual documentation provides an objective and undeniable record of the scene’s condition immediately following the accident, helping to illustrate the circumstances and impact to insurance adjusters, opposing counsel, or a jury.
- Securing Surveillance Footage – In today’s world, cameras are everywhere. We actively work to secure surveillance footage from traffic cameras, nearby businesses, residential security systems, or even dash cams. This video evidence can often provide an unbiased account of the accident itself, showing how it unfolded, who was at fault, and the actions of all parties involved. Time is often of the essence here, as many surveillance systems automatically overwrite footage after a short period.
- Identifying and Interviewing Witnesses – Witnesses often provide crucial, objective perspectives on what occurred. Our team goes beyond the initial police report to identify potential witnesses who may have seen the accident but didn’t speak to authorities at the scene. We then conduct thorough interviews, gathering detailed statements about what they observed before, during, and after the incident. Their accounts can corroborate your version of events, identify negligent actions, or reveal critical details overlooked by others.
- Obtaining Police Reports and Official Documentation – The police report is often one of the first official documents generated after an accident, and it contains vital initial information. We promptly obtain and meticulously review this report, along with any other official documentation, such as incident reports from property owners or employer accident reports. These documents provide a framework for our investigation and often contain initial assessments of the scene, vehicle information, and witness contact details.
- Collecting Medical Records and Billing Statements – Proving the extent of your injuries and the financial burden they’ve imposed is critical. We meticulously collect all relevant medical records and billing statements from every healthcare provider you’ve seen, from emergency services and hospitals to specialists, therapists, and pharmacies. This comprehensive collection allows us to fully document the nature of your injuries, the course of your treatment, and the financial impact on your life.
- Reviewing Vehicle Damage Reports and Repair Estimates – For accidents involving vehicles, vehicle damage reports and repair estimates offer valuable insights into the force of impact and can corroborate the severity of the collision. We review these documents to understand the full extent of property damage, which can sometimes provide clues about the mechanics of the accident itself and the potential for corresponding personal injuries.
- Analyzing Employment Records (for lost wages claims) – If your injuries have caused you to miss work or affected your ability to earn a living, analyzing employment records becomes a key part of our investigation. We gather documentation of your past earnings, work history, and any records demonstrating time lost due to the accident. This evidence is crucial for calculating and substantiating claims for lost wages and diminished earning capacity.

Leveraging Expert Resources for In-Depth Analysis
While our in-house investigative team is incredibly thorough, complex accident cases often require specialized knowledge and technical insights that go beyond the scope of a standard investigation. At The Orlow Firm, we recognize that to truly understand the nuances of an accident and accurately quantify its impact, we need to bring in the best. That’s why we frequently leverage a network of highly credentialed expert resources across various fields. These specialists provide critical analysis, generate detailed reports, and can offer powerful testimony, significantly strengthening your claim.
-
Accident Reconstruction Specialists: In vehicle accidents where the cause isn’t immediately clear, or there’s conflicting information, we often enlist accident reconstruction specialists. These experts use scientific principles, physics, and advanced technology to re-create the accident sequence, analyze vehicle dynamics, impact forces, and driver behavior. Their findings can pinpoint the precise cause of the accident and definitively establish fault, often based on data from vehicle black boxes, skid marks, and crush damage.
-
Medical Experts (Doctors, Therapists, Rehabilitation Specialists): Understanding the full extent of your injuries—and their long-term implications—is paramount. We consult with a range of medical experts, including orthopedic surgeons, neurologists, pain management specialists, physical therapists, and rehabilitation specialists. These professionals can provide detailed medical opinions on the severity of your injuries, the necessity of past and future treatments, your prognosis, and the potential for permanent disability, ensuring that your compensation accurately reflects your medical needs.
-
Economic Impact Analysts: When an accident results in significant financial losses, such as lost wages, diminished earning capacity, or future medical costs, we work with economic impact analysts. These experts are skilled at calculating the full scope of financial damages, projecting future lost income, benefits, and the cost of ongoing care. Their detailed reports provide a clear, quantifiable basis for the economic portion of your claim.
-
Vocational Rehabilitation Experts: For clients whose injuries affect their ability to return to their previous job or any gainful employment, vocational rehabilitation experts become invaluable. They assess your residual functional capacity, identify suitable alternative occupations, and determine the cost of retraining or educational programs. Their analysis helps us claim compensation for lost earning potential over your lifetime.
-
Forensic Engineers (for product liability or structural issues): In cases involving defective products, faulty machinery, or structural failures that contributed to an accident, we may engage forensic engineers. These specialists can examine the product or structure, identify design flaws, manufacturing defects, or maintenance failures, and determine how these issues led to your injury. Their expertise is crucial in holding manufacturers or property owners accountable.

Establishing Liability: Proving Who Was At Fault
A successful personal injury claim isn’t just about showing you were injured; it’s fundamentally about establishing liability – proving who was at fault for causing your accident and, therefore, your injuries. This is often the most contentious part of any claim, as insurance companies and opposing parties will aggressively try to minimize their responsibility or shift blame. At The Orlow Firm, our meticulous investigation feeds directly into this crucial phase, allowing us to build a compelling case that clearly identifies all negligent parties.
Analyzing Traffic Laws and Regulations
Many accidents occur due to a violation of established rules. We thoroughly analyze traffic laws and regulations, as well as any other relevant statutes or industry standards, that apply to your specific accident. For instance, in a car accident, did the other driver run a red light, exceed the speed limit, or make an illegal turn? In a slip and fall, did a property owner violate building codes or safety regulations? By identifying these infractions, we can demonstrate how a party’s failure to adhere to the law directly contributed to your accident. This legal framework forms a powerful basis for proving negligence.
Identifying All Responsible Parties
It’s not always just one person or entity to blame. Our investigation aims to identify all responsible parties who may have contributed to your accident. This could include:
- Drivers: In vehicle collisions, the most obvious liable party.
- Property Owners: For premises liability cases (like slip and falls), if unsafe conditions led to your injury.
- Employers: If the accident occurred due to an employer’s negligence or while an employee was acting within the scope of their employment.
- Product Manufacturers: If a defective product caused or contributed to your injuries.
- Governmental Entities: In some cases, poorly maintained roads or malfunctioning traffic signals might involve a municipal or state entity.
By identifying every party whose negligence played a role, we maximize the potential sources of compensation for your injuries.
Building a Compelling Narrative of Negligence
Ultimately, proving liability involves building a compelling narrative of negligence. This means connecting all the evidence we’ve gathered – witness statements, police reports, expert analyses, medical records, and photos – into a clear, cohesive story that demonstrates how another party’s careless actions (or inactions) directly led to your harm. We meticulously show that:
- The responsible party owed you a duty of care (e.g., to drive safely, to maintain a safe property).
- They breached that duty (e.g., by driving recklessly, by failing to fix a hazard).
- This breach directly caused your accident and injuries.
- You suffered damages as a result.

Quantifying Damages: Accurately Assessing Your Losses
Beyond proving who was at fault, a critical part of securing fair compensation is accurately quantifying your damages. This means meticulously assessing every single loss you’ve suffered because of the accident—not just the obvious ones. Insurance companies will always try to minimize these figures, so a thorough, evidence-backed calculation of your damages is absolutely essential. At The Orlow Firm, we leave no stone unturned, ensuring that every impact the accident has had on your life is accounted for and included in your claim.
-
Calculating Medical Expenses (Past, Present, and Future): Your medical bills are often the most immediate and significant cost after an accident. We diligently gather all your past medical expenses, from emergency room visits and ambulance rides to hospital stays, surgeries, medications, and diagnostic tests. But our assessment doesn’t stop there. We work with your doctors and medical experts to project your present and future medical needs, including ongoing treatments, therapies, rehabilitation, potential future surgeries, and long-term care, ensuring these crucial costs are fully integrated into your claim.
-
Estimating Lost Wages and Diminished Earning Capacity: Accidents can take a serious toll on your financial stability. We thoroughly document all your lost wages from time missed at work due to your injuries, recovery, and appointments. Furthermore, if your injuries prevent you from returning to your previous job or earning the same income you did before, we work with vocational and economic experts to calculate your diminished earning capacity. This accounts for the future income you’ll lose over your lifetime due to your accident-related limitations.
-
Valuing Pain and Suffering: While harder to quantify, pain and suffering are very real and compensable damages. This includes the physical pain you’ve endured, the discomfort of your injuries, and the suffering through treatments and recovery. We gather evidence like medical records, your personal testimony, and, if necessary, expert medical opinions to demonstrate the severity and impact of your pain on your daily life.
-
Assessing Emotional Distress: Accidents often lead to significant emotional distress, including anxiety, depression, PTSD, fear, sleeplessness, and other psychological impacts. These non-economic damages can profoundly affect your quality of life. We work to document this distress through medical records, therapy notes, and personal accounts, ensuring these crucial aspects of your suffering are recognized and valued.
-
Accounting for Property Damage: If your property was damaged in the accident—whether it’s your vehicle, motorcycle, bicycle, or other personal belongings—we make sure to account for all property damage. This includes the cost of repairs, replacement value, or any diminution in value of your property.
-
Considering Future Care and Rehabilitation Needs: Some injuries require long-term support. We meticulously calculate the costs associated with future care and rehabilitation needs, such as ongoing physical therapy, occupational therapy, specialized equipment, home modifications, or even in-home care. Our goal is to ensure you receive the resources needed for a full recovery and a good quality of life moving forward.

What should I do at the accident scene to help your investigation later? If you are able and it is safe to do so, immediately after an accident, you should:
- Call 911 (police and ambulance).
- Exchange information with other involved parties (name, insurance, contact).
- Take photos and videos of the scene, vehicles, and injuries from various angles.
- Get contact information for any witnesses.
- Do not admit fault or apologize.
- Seek immediate medical attention.
